In pictures: Avani Modi, a girl from Gandhinagar is new Tamil film heroine
May 02, 2013








Gandhinagar, 2 May 2013
A girl from Gandhinagar Gujarat has become Tamil film heroine with her first Tamil film release this week.
Avani has played a role of main actress in Rajavagha Pogirin film with hero as Nakul kumar.
Born in Gandhinagar, Avani completed her education in HL college of Ahmedabad. She has anchored ETV Gujarati’s Git Gunjan and Yuva Sangram programmes in past. She has also performed in Airtel and other ads. She has played roles in TV serials on Soni TV and Zee TV and in Ataf Raja’s video album by Venus.
Avani will play role in two more Tamil films in near future.
